You can find 4 key historic layout influences visible in Notre Dame Cathedral Paris. To begin with, the cathedral displays considerable Romanesque influences. This design and style, commonplace in Europe throughout the 11th and 12th hundreds of years, is characterised by thick partitions, rounded arches, and small windows. Things of Romanesque design might be noticed in the reduced parts from the cathedral, such as the sturdy piers and the decorative sculptures adorning the exterior. Secondly, the cathedral showcases notable Gothic influences. The Gothic architectural design emerged during the twelfth century, characterised by pointed arches, ribbed vaults, and traveling buttresses. These attributes are prominently displayed inside the Cathédrale Notre-Dame de Paris, especially in its upper stages. The pointed arches develop a feeling of height and class, though the ribbed vaults allow for greater structural stability as well as soaring verticality of the inside Place.

The cathedral also has some elements in the afterwards Rayonnant Gothic style, like the solitary-arch traveling buttresses that aid the apse. The cathedral underwent numerous modifications and restorations about the generations. Inside the 18th century, several of its Gothic options had been taken out or replaced by classical ones. While in the nineteenth century, A significant restoration challenge by Eugène Viollet-le-Duc restored the cathedral to its original Gothic physical appearance and added a whole new spire. In 2019, a fire broken the roof, the spire, and several of the inside. A reconstruction project is underway to restore the cathedral to its former glory.

Thirdly, the cathedral incorporates factors of French Gothic design, which developed from the broader Gothic design and style. The notable capabilities consist of the rose windows, which are substantial circular stained glass Home windows with intricate tracery. The Notre Dame Cathedral Paris showcases a few magnificent rose Home windows, by far the most well-known currently being the west rose window. These windows certainly are a testament to your skilled craftsmanship in the time period and contribute to your cathedral’s overall aesthetic attraction. And finally, the Cathédrale Notre-Dame de Paris also bears the affect of medieval French architecture. The cathedral’s sculptural decorations and ornate facts replicate the inventive sensibilities of your medieval interval. The intricate stone carvings on the facade as well as the statues filling the portals exemplify the craftsmanship and religious symbolism integral to medieval architectural design and style.
